• Ancestral clear title at 60 hectares — the institutional documentation premium — clear ancestral title on a 60+ hectare parcel in Goa is genuinely exceptional. Large ancestral land holdings in North Goa are typically characterised by complex multi-generational inheritance chains, fragmented survey numbers, and contested family claims — complications that make large-format ancestral land transactions among the most legally complex in the state. Clear title on a parcel of this scale signals that the ownership chain is unusually well-maintained and legally defensible — a property that institutional buyers, development finance lenders, and legal advisors can work with confidently. Dhargalim is a village in Pernem taluka, the northernmost taluka of North Goa, bordering Maharashtra and sitting within Goa's most actively re-rating real estate corridor. Pernem is home to the Mopa International Airport — Goa's second international airport — whose operational ramp-up is systematically repricing land values across the entire taluka, with the most significant appreciation concentrated in well-connected villages within the airport's practical catchment radius. The taluka is also characterised by some of North Goa's most pristine natural landscape — river systems, agricultural land, and a gradually developing premium residential and hospitality ecosystem anchored by the coastal villages of Arambol, Mandrem, and Morjim to the west. What legal due diligence is required for a 150-acre ancestral land acquisition in Goa? Title search across all survey numbers, Form I & XIV for each, encumbrance certificates, succession deed verification, zoning confirmation by survey number, and mutation record review are all required.
